Tangentially related, Anandtech got a look at the upcoming (Q4) Nehalem CPU. This thing is going to be a beast.
Take Penryn, add in HyperThreading that should no longer be a burden (thanks to 4 innate cores), and implement an integrated memory controller - the same feature that gave AMD it's short lived wonder years with Athlon64.
